On Friday 16th May, I was delighted to welcome Owen Paterson, the Secretary of State for the Environment, Food and Rural Affairs, to my constituency to visit BPI Recycled Products in Heanor.
I was delighted to show the Minister the great work they do at BPI, including their latest £1.5 million investment in their recycling line, which brings back jobs from China to Amber Valley.
We discussed the potential impact of the carrier bag tax due to come in to force in 2015 and the potential implications that such a tax would have on jobs in Heanor.
